Description
Technical field
The utility model relates to a kind of flour-extruding machine, specifically, relates to a kind of flour-extruding machine with oiling mechanism.
Background technology
Deep-fried twisted dough sticks are fried expansion wheaten food of a kind of strip, and it is sustained that its mouthfeel is crisp, are one of Chinese tradition breakfast, very popular.It is manually by slitting after dough compressing tablet that traditional deep-fried twisted dough sticks make, and then stacked by the noodles that two cut, and with chopsticks, longitudinally extruding one ditch thereon makes fried bread stick dough base, finally puts into oil fried ripe.The deep-fried twisted dough sticks that conventional method needs certain skill to make, and profile is good-looking, taste is nice.
Along with the development of society, the extensive use of mechanized equipment, people also expect that deep-fried twisted dough sticks also can be made by mechanical device, not only can reduce the dependence of deep-fried twisted dough sticks making to manual dexterity, also can improve the make efficiency of deep-fried twisted dough sticks to a certain extent, meet business-like demand.Through the analysis of professional researcher, the three large difficult points utilizing mechanical device to make deep-fried twisted dough sticks are that dough ingredients, face base are shaping and fried respectively.Someone have developed the flour-extruding machine being made fried bread stick dough base by fashion of extrusion at present, and its operation principle is that the dough mixed is put into a container, utilizes pressure to extrude in strip by dough from the outlet that it is established, and then cuts fried respectively again.Which changes deep-fried twisted dough sticks molding mode (original two unifications become single noodles) to a certain extent, its final fried shaping after more mellow and fuller attractive in appearance, be also subject to youthfully liking.
But because dough tool is a bit sticky, after extruding and plate contact there is a strong possibility makes it be bonded on panel, so subsequent operation is affected.Common solution manually on panel, spills some flour, and dough is more easily separated, and so then must have people always in the other operation of flour-extruding machine, comparatively bother.
Utility model content
For overcoming the problems referred to above of the prior art, the utility model provides the flour-extruding machine with oiling mechanism that a kind of structure is simple, easy to use, effectively can prevent dough haftplatte.

Embodiment
As depicted in figs. 1 and 2, should with the flour-extruding machine of oiling mechanism, comprise the cabinet 10 with inner chamber 11, be arranged on the screw shaft 12 in inner chamber, be opened in the discharging opening 13 on the inner chamber of screw shaft end, be positioned at the junction plate 14 be connected below discharging opening and with cabinet, and to be arranged on above cabinet and with the charging box 15 of inner space, also comprise the oiling guide rail 1 on the cabinet being horizontally installed on discharging opening top, by the installing plate 2 that guide rail slide block is connected with oiling guide rail, be arranged on cabinet for driving installing plate along the drive unit 3 of oiling guide rail movement, be arranged on installing plate bottom and the horizontal push pedal 4 arranged perpendicular to discharging opening plane, be arranged at horizontal push pedal near discharging opening one end and blank plate 5 parallel plane with discharging opening, be arranged on the polish applying shoes-brush 6 in horizontal push pedal, be arranged on horizontal one end on junction plate and the oil groove 7 mated with polish applying shoes-brush, and be fixedly installed on the horizontal other end of junction plate and the discharging guide groove 16 of oblique setting.Particularly, described blank plate is near the cabinet medial plane at discharging opening place.In order to keep dexterous actions, described horizontal push pedal lower end and connect between panel upper surface and there is gap, polish applying shoes-brush contacts with the upper surface of junction plate.Particularly, in the present embodiment, preferred drive unit is the cylinder being arranged on cabinet and being connected with installing plate.Preferred as another kind, described drive unit comprises and is fixed on cabinet and is positioned at the motor of oiling guide rail one end, to be arranged on cabinet and to be positioned at the synchronizing wheel of the oiling guide rail other end, and being connected to the Timing Belt be fixedly connected with between motor and synchronizing wheel and with installing plate.
When the utility model uses, horizontal push pedal first drives polish applying shoes-brush action once oiling on junction plate, screw shaft rotates and dough is extruded from discharging opening, and drop on junction plate by discharging opening, when reaching the length of required deep-fried twisted dough sticks, cylinder action makes horizontal push pedal move, now noodles cut off along discharging opening by blank plate, horizontal push pedal simultaneously pushes the noodles of cut-out to side, make owing to junction plate there being edible oil to keep between noodles with plate being separated and sliding, the noodles cut are easy to just to move on to side and can not haftplatte, the polish applying shoes-brush be now connected with horizontal push pedal also again through junction plate to its oiling, finally drive to reset next time at cylinder and put, polish applying shoes-brush dips in oil from oil groove, noodles continue to be extruded and then repeat said process.
